Subject: Unable to build current kernel
To: None <current-users@NetBSD.org>
From: Jan H. van Gils <JanVG@Knoware.NL>
List: current-users
Date: 12/01/2004 22:22:24
Hi,

Thanks for reading.

I still have problems with building GENERIC.

The only way to build a current kernel is to remark the ath driver in =
the
GENERIC file.
There is a note in src/UPDATING but I don't know how to use that =
information
:-(

Can somebody tell me how to solve this problem ?
As a workaround I remark ath in the GENERIC file before building the =
kernel.
But I think there has to be an other way.

With regards Jan

>>>> Part of the log file

#   compile  BORG/vers.o
/build/tools/bin/i386--netbsdelf-gcc      -ffreestanding   -O2 -Werror =
-Wall
-Wn
o-main -Wno-format-zero-length -Wpointer-arith -Wmissing-prototypes
-Wstrict-pro
totypes -Wno-sign-compare -fno-zero-initialized-in-bss  -Di386 -I.
-I../../../.
./arch -I../../../.. -nostdinc -DLKM -DMAXUSERS=3D32 -D_KERNEL =
-D_KERNEL_OPT
-I../
../../../dist/ipf  -c vers.c
#      link  BORG/netbsd
/build/tools/bin/i386--netbsdelf-ld -T
../../../../arch/i386/conf/kern.ldscript
-Ttext c0100000 -e start -X -o netbsd ${SYSTEM_OBJ} ${EXTRA_OBJ} vers.o
/build/tools/bin/i386--netbsdelf-ld: cannot open athhal-elf.o: No such =
file
or d
irectory
*** Error code 1

Stop.
make: stopped in /build/current/src/sys/arch/i386/compile/BORG

----
With regards Jan H. van Gils
Internet web-page http://www.Knoware.NL/users/janvg/
Internet e-mail address JanVG[at]Knoware.NL
RIPE Whois JHG5-RIPE, 6BONE Whois JHG1-6BONE
=20